Major Food Group (MFG) is a hospitality company founded by Mario Carbone, Rich Torrisi, and Jeff Zalaznick. From a small, intimate restaurant located in Little Italy, MFG has evolved into a hospitality powerhouse, creating some of New York City's most popular and iconic restaurants, garnering national and international attention along the way for its unique style and culinary prowess. Today, MFG is one of the fastest growing hospitality companies in the United States.
MFG currently operates eighteen restaurants and bars: THE GRILL, THE POOL, The Pool Lounge and The Lobster Club, all located in the historic Seagram Building; Carbone (New York, Hong Kong, Las Vegas), ZZ’s Clam Bar, Dirty French, Santina, Parm (Soho, Upper West Side, Battery Park, Barclays Center), Sadelle’s (New York and Las Vegas) and The Polynesian. MFG also operates Lobby Bar and provides all food, beverage and event services for The Ludlow hotel.
